Anti-Depressant Properties of Crocin Molecules in Saffron
Saffron is a valued herb, obtained from the stigmas of the C. sativus Linn (Iridaceae), with therapeutic effects. It has been described in pharmacopoeias to be variously acting, including as an anti-depressant, anti-carcinogen, and stimulant agent.

The effect of composition and shape variations on compressive strength slag depressant
The steel-making process begins with a reduction process carried out in a blast furnace (BF) then continues with the refining process in the converter. In the refining process, there is a slag foam formed from the reaction of oxygen with hot metal.
